The focus of this class will be the study of the 21st century English Language Literature in its social, political, and ethno-cultural context. The course requires a strong commitment to reading. The reading workload might be up to 100 pages per week. Novels by Martin Amis, Ishiguro Kazuo, Ian McEwan, Julian Barnes, Irvin Welsh, Salman Rushdie, Zadie Smith, Peter Ackroyd, and John Coetzee will be read and discussed. Students will be required to write significantly in class and at home. In the midterm and final papers, students will be expected to discuss a work of literature using an interdisciplinary approach.
